AEI to convert three 737-400SFs for ASL Aviation

Aeronautical Engineers (AEI) is converting three Boeing 737-400SFs for ASL Aviation Group, to be redelivered in May, June and July this year.

The three aircraft, registrations MSN 25177, MS24917 and MSN 26025, are being converted at Commercial Jet’s Miami facility.

The aircraft will have 11 pallet positions and AEI says it is the only 737-400 passenger to freighter conversion with 10 88 x 125 inches positions, because the main deck cargo door is 40 inches further back than competitors. The company says this increases capacity by 10 per cent.
